diff options
author | raveit65 <[email protected]> | 2017-04-24 11:33:25 +0200 |
---|---|---|
committer | raveit65 <[email protected]> | 2017-05-16 17:51:13 +0200 |
commit | f53a87e20e12222526aec8b7e362d47ceb0de49a (patch) | |
tree | 46206d4c7824fa30f1b421bcc5ee18011f2b9d1c /capplets/about-me/eel-alert-dialog.c | |
parent | 6f83da9ef9d63bda0e6e7a2a47b2deabce5da33e (diff) | |
download | mate-control-center-f53a87e20e12222526aec8b7e362d47ceb0de49a.tar.bz2 mate-control-center-f53a87e20e12222526aec8b7e362d47ceb0de49a.tar.xz |
eel-alert-dialog: replace some GtkStock items
Diffstat (limited to 'capplets/about-me/eel-alert-dialog.c')
-rw-r--r-- | capplets/about-me/eel-alert-dialog.c | 26 |
1 files changed, 13 insertions, 13 deletions
diff --git a/capplets/about-me/eel-alert-dialog.c b/capplets/about-me/eel-alert-dialog.c index cbf28edf..37854657 100644 --- a/capplets/about-me/eel-alert-dialog.c +++ b/capplets/about-me/eel-alert-dialog.c @@ -158,7 +158,8 @@ eel_alert_dialog_init (EelAlertDialog *dialog) dialog->details->primary_label = gtk_label_new (NULL); dialog->details->secondary_label = gtk_label_new (NULL); dialog->details->details_label = gtk_label_new (NULL); - dialog->details->image = gtk_image_new_from_stock (NULL, GTK_ICON_SIZE_DIALOG); +// dialog->details->image = gtk_image_new_from_stock (NULL, GTK_ICON_SIZE_DIALOG); + dialog->details->image = gtk_image_new_from_icon_name (NULL, GTK_ICON_SIZE_DIALOG); gtk_widget_set_halign (dialog->details->image, GTK_ALIGN_CENTER); gtk_widget_set_valign (dialog->details->image, GTK_ALIGN_START); @@ -225,36 +226,35 @@ static void setup_type (EelAlertDialog *dialog, GtkMessageType type) { - const gchar *stock_id = NULL; - GtkStockItem item; + const gchar *icon_name = NULL; switch (type) { case GTK_MESSAGE_INFO: - stock_id = GTK_STOCK_DIALOG_INFO; + icon_name = "dialog-information"; break; case GTK_MESSAGE_QUESTION: - stock_id = GTK_STOCK_DIALOG_QUESTION; + icon_name = "dialog-question"; break; case GTK_MESSAGE_WARNING: - stock_id = GTK_STOCK_DIALOG_WARNING; + icon_name = "dialog-warning"; break; case GTK_MESSAGE_ERROR: - stock_id = GTK_STOCK_DIALOG_ERROR; + icon_name = "dialog-error"; break; default: g_warning ("Unknown GtkMessageType %d", type); break; } - if (stock_id == NULL) { - stock_id = GTK_STOCK_DIALOG_INFO; + if (icon_name == NULL) { + icon_name = "dialog-information"; } - if (gtk_stock_lookup (stock_id, &item)) { - gtk_image_set_from_stock (GTK_IMAGE (dialog->details->image), stock_id, - GTK_ICON_SIZE_DIALOG); + if (icon_name) { + gtk_image_set_from_icon_name (GTK_IMAGE (dialog->details->image), icon_name, + GTK_ICON_SIZE_DIALOG); } else { - g_warning ("Stock dialog ID doesn't exist?"); + g_warning ("Dialog icon-name doesn't exist?"); } } |